The Senior Legal Counsel position is a key strategic role providing comprehensive legal leadership across Canada and supporting critical Brand and Compliance initiatives throughout the North America (NAM) region, including the United States, Canada, and the Caribbean. This role serves as a trusted advisor to senior leadership, ensuring legal integrity while enabling business growth and safeguarding Ferrero’s interests.
Job Location: 100 Sheppard Avenue East, North York, ON M2N 6N5
Work Arrangement: Hybrid – 3 days onsite, 2 days remote
Support all Canadian legal matters, including corporate governance, commercial contracts, litigation, intellectual property, regulatory compliance, and food law.
• Advise on Brand & Compliance Across NAM
Support marketing, advertising, and regulatory compliance for brand initiatives throughout North America (U.S., Canada, Caribbean). Drive compliance governance and risk management programs regionally.
• Compliance Leadership
Design and deliver compliance training, monitor regulatory developments, and lead risk assessments on key topics (e.g., anti-bribery, antitrust, privacy). Conduct investigations and recommend remediation as needed.
• Governance & Policy Deployment
Implement Group and Area legal strategies, policies, and standards in Canada. Serve as Corporate Secretary and ensure strong governance practices.
• Enable Business & Manage Risk
Partner with leadership teams to align business objectives with legal and regulatory requirements. Develop best practices and compliance programs to protect Ferrero’s reputation and assets.
• Litigation & Dispute Resolution
Manage Canadian litigation and coordinate with external counsel. Provide proactive advice to prevent disputes and mitigate risks.
• Cross-Functional Partnership
Collaborate with marketing, supply chain, industrial, finance, P&O, and other teams to enable compliant business operations.
A strategic, business-oriented legal leader who combines deep legal expertise with strong commercial acumen and the ability to influence decision-making at the highest levels.
- Minimum 7+ years of progressive experience as in-house counsel or in a leading law firm, with a focus on advising senior management and shaping legal strategy.
- Juris Doctor (J.D.) or equivalent law degree from an accredited institution; admission to the bar in a Canadian province required; U.S. licensure preferred.
- Background in Food Law, Intellectual Property, Advertising & Marketing Law, Data Protection (Canada), and Corporate Law.
- Ability to anticipate risks, design compliance frameworks, and align legal solutions with business objectives across multiple jurisdictions.
- Demonstrated success in collaborating with cross-functional teams and influencing outcomes in a complex, matrixed organization.
